Richard Stevens 04-16-2013 05:20 PM

Re: Training in Japan
 
Quote:

Aviv Goldsmith wrote: (Post 325385)
One of our students is being deployed to Iwakuni. Does anyone have first hand info about the dojos there or in Yamaguchi-ken? Arigato.

The base gym in Iwakuni has a nice dojo and the last I heard Aikido classes were still available. They were being taught by the Aikikai group that has a dojo not far from the train station in downtown Iwakuni. From base it would only be a 30 minute bike ride.
